π Iterative Refinement for Osceola Mills Projects
Professional Osceola Mills developers use iterative prompting to achieve production-ready code that meets local industry standards and performance requirements.
Osceola Mills Iterative Prompting Sequence:
Initial Prompt: "Create a user authentication system for a Osceola Mills SaaS startup"
Refinement 1: "Perfect! Now add USA privacy compliance and multi-factor authentication"
Refinement 2: "Great! Optimize this for 50,000+ Osceola Mills users with Redis caching"
Final Touch: "Excellent! Add monitoring for Osceola Mills production deployment"

π Debugging for Osceola Mills Production Environments
Osceola Mills Production Debugging Prompt:
"I'm getting intermittent 504 timeout errors in our Osceola Mills production API serving USA customers. The error occurs during peak Osceola Mills business hours (9 AM - 6 PM USA time). Here's the problematic code:
[Insert your production code]
Error logs show: [Insert exact error messages]
Please: 1) Identify potential causes related to Osceola Mills traffic patterns, 2) Suggest fixes that work with our USA cloud infrastructure, 3) Recommend monitoring solutions for Osceola Mills deployment."
